Two-Factor Authentication Issues
Solutions for common 2FA problems — wrong codes, lost authenticator, and backup code issues.
2FA Code is Being Rejected
Check your phone's clock is correct — TOTP codes are time-based. If your phone's clock is off by more than 30 seconds, the codes will be wrong. Go to your phone's settings and enable automatic time sync.
Use the code immediately — TOTP codes refresh every 30 seconds. Enter the code as soon as you see it, before it refreshes.
Check you are using the right account — if you have multiple entries in your authenticator app (e.g. personal and work), make sure you are copying the code from the SMLLR entry, not another service.
Lost Access to Your Authenticator App
Each backup code can only be used once. Once used, it is invalidated for security.
Use a backup code
On the 2FA login screen, click Use a backup code. Enter one of the one-time backup codes you saved when you set up 2FA.
Log in and disable 2FA
After logging in with a backup code, immediately go to Settings → Security and disable 2FA.
Re-enable 2FA on your new device
Set up 2FA fresh on your new phone by following the 2FA setup guide.
No Backup Codes and Lost Authenticator
If you cannot access your authenticator app AND you do not have your backup codes, contact SMLLR support at [email protected]. We will need to verify your identity before resetting 2FA on your account.
This process may take 24–48 hours for security reasons. Please include:
- Your registered email address
- Your full name
- Any recent invoice numbers or payment reference numbers
- Your GST details if applicable
We take account security very seriously and will not bypass 2FA without thorough identity verification. This protects you in case someone else is trying to access your account.
